SCI8-WaterCycle

Water Cycle and Weathering (EPISD 8th grade)

QuestionAnswer
Mechanical Weathering caused by the physical forces of nature
Chemical Weathering caused by reactions that break down rock
Erosion When small pieces of rock are carried away
Sediment Small pieces of rock moved by erosion
Deposition When sediments are moved and deposited into a new place
Delta A land form at the mouth of a river caused by deposition
Sun The engine of the water cycle
Evaporation When liquid water is changed to water vapor
Condensation When water vapor collects in the sky
Precipitation Rain, snow, sleet or hail
Transpiration Water evaporates off the leaves of plants
Percolation When water soaks into the ground
Collection Water that gathers together in one place
Runoff Water that doesn’t soak in but moves downhill to a stream
Aquifer An underground collection of water
Watershed An area of land where the water all drains to the same place
Rain A common form of precipitation
Hail Frozen ice that falls from the sky
Sleet Frozen rain
Snow Santa’s favorite form of precipitation
Water vapor The gas form of water
